I am having a tightness in the center of my chest with a little restricted breathing. This has been going off and on for a couple of weeks, but is worse as of yesterday. It is worse when I do something strenuous and better when sit and rest. With in the last month have had an echocardigram and nuclear stress test . So, am inclined to believe it is not a problem with the heart

Hi Thank you for asking HCM. I have gone through your query. Your problem can be due to costochondritis. Pain while palpation on rib area is characteristic for this. For such cases i would recommend using anti inflammatory gels like ketoprofen for local application. You can also take oral tablets of it if pain is more. If there is no improvement then local injection of corticosteroids or anesthetic will be helpful. Hope this may help you. Let me know if anything not clear. Thanks.
